logo

Output 38d7345586888dc7e0961bbc4d2efa83c629da733a77a26b0ac94c7c5b629a8f:0

value
1238763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708bb26c4eb89f0bfd9759b6daa80d6411084b07 OP_EQUAL
address
3Bx6xLugGz2CSaGjDojaTLGDzoRHQLssbE
transaction
38d7345586888dc7e0961bbc4d2efa83c629da733a77a26b0ac94c7c5b629a8f